Summary With Santana Pike being named the second graduate, six nominees remain at the Centre. The nominees' first challenge is to test if they know how fast they are driving by covering their speedometer. They are required to drive at both 50kph and 70kph, the latter which also entails them hitting on their brakes at a given point to avoid hitting a wall, which they should be able to do if they are indeed driving at the requested speed. Their second challenge is the annual water tank challenge, which includes a straightaway acceleration and deceleration section, a forward precision steering section, a dirt mound section, an S-turn section, and a reverse slalom section. Needless to say, more than a few people get wet including one surprised host. After receiving a lesson from Philippe on high speed swerving, the nominees are then asked to do a high speed swerve challenge to avoid hitting an obstacle that will pop up at the last minute. Philippe stresses that they should look for a solution rather than look at the obstacle which results in what he calls target fixation. Before these challenges, George, who is teaching is sixteen year old son Cody how to drive, expresses concern that he is transferring his own bad habits to Cody by osmosis. As such, without George's knowledge, Cody is brought to the Centre, he who is given driving lessons by Tim. It ends up being an eye opening experience for both father and son.
